Explanation:
Charge, q = 2 e = 2 x 1.6 x 10^-19 C = 3.2 x 10^-19 C
Electric field strength, E = 790 N/C
mass of helium nucleus, m = 6.645 x 10^-27 Kg
the force due to electric filed on a charge particle is given by
F = q x E
Where, q be the charge on the charged particle and E be the strength of electric field.
By substituting the values
F = 3.2 x 10^-19 x 790
F = 2528 x 10^-19 N
According to the Newton's second law
F = m x a
Where, me be the mass and a be the acceleration
By substituting the values

a = 3.8 x 10^10 m/s^2

Proteins are broken down into amino acids considered the foundational element. When issued, these tiny molecules can then be consumed into the bloodstream via the gut wall. An enzyme is a protein which can regulate biochemical response rate. An enzyme integrates a water molecule around the bond in enzymatic hydrolysis processes which allows it to split.
The bonds which hold together the amino acids are recognized as peptide bonds. A hydrolysis process comparable to that included in splitting up carbohydrates is required to break the peptide bonds within a protein. Enzymes identified as proteases are required for the protein to disintegrate.
